Missouri Department of Health and Senior Services Director Randall Williams announced the state would receive at least 339,775 COVID-19 vaccine doses by the end of the month.
Williams said the shipment should cover most of the state's roughly 350,000 long-term care facility residents and staff and health care providers.
Williams said he expects mass vaccinations to begin in May.
